Elsenham Station boasts a range of ticketing facilities to facilitate a seamless travel experience. The ticket office is open from 06:00 to 13:30 from Monday to Saturday, ensuring you can get tickets or resolve queries in person. Although not operational on Sundays, you’ll find ticket machines on-site for round-the-clock service, allowing you to collect pre-purchased tickets at your convenience.
The station has suitably accessible infrastructure. With step-free access available between platforms via Old Mead Road, travellers with mobility needs are well-catered for. There's also an induction loop available for those with hearing impairments, making the station user-friendly for all.
While Elsenham may lack some facilities like luggage storage and toilets, it compensates with its service offerings in other areas. Refreshments can be found by the entrance to Platform 2, ensuring you stay nourished on your travels. Public Wi-Fi is available to keep you connected, and sheltered bicycle storage caters to cyclists, providing stands on each platform.
Safety is assured as the station is equipped with CCTV, and help points are strategically located to assist travellers as needed. While there aren't any launch facilities or 1st Class lounges, waiting rooms with seating areas are available, offering a comfortable spot to rest between journeys.
Getting to and from Elsenham Station is made easy with various transport links. While there are no accessible taxis or dedicated set-down points, local bus services integrate seamlessly with the train schedules. For those unexpected schedule changes, rail replacement services can be accessed at the nearby Station Road and New Road bus stop.

Glossop Station welcomes passengers with a range of facilities designed to improve your travel experience. The ticket office operates with generous hours, welcoming visitors from early in the morning until late in the evening on weekdays. It also maintains a presence on Sundays, albeit with shorter hours. A convenient ticket machine is available for collecting pre-purchased tickets and is accessible for all travelers, including wheelchair users. For tech-savvy travelers, smartcards are also an option at this station.
Those requiring assistance will find ample support, with staff available during most operating hours. Step-free access throughout the station speaks to its commitment to inclusivity. For travelers needing just a little extra help, you can arrange assistance in advance, using the convenient Passenger Assist service. Getting to and from Glossop Station is straightforward, thanks to various transport links. You'll find the Rail Replacement Bus services neatly departing from Norfolk Street, ensuring no journey is left unresolved even in times of planned engineering works. You can count on taxi services, which you can explore further at cab4you, to whisk you away to your final destination. Although there are no bicycle hire services directly at the station, Glossop’s connectivity ensures you’re never far from the next form of transport.
